Key fobs

Most newer cars feature key fobs that are similar to car key programmer near me remotes, but more portable. They are equipped with a tiny radio transmitter that transmits a unique coded signal to the receiver in the vehicle. When you press a button on the fob, it communicates with the receiver to open the door or start the engine.

Although these devices are useful and offer additional security, they can be vulnerable to hacking. A $50 piece of hardware for example, can be used by hackers to intercept the signal between the key fobs as well as the cars. Some car companies are trying to improve their systems to make them safer.

Transponders

Transponders are an essential component of key fobs, as well as other vehicle security devices. They work by sending low-frequency signals to a receiver situated in the ignition. If the signal is in line with the code that is programmed into the car's system, then the vehicle starts. They also appear in remote controls for garages, gates, and homes. Remote control keys are different from traditional mechanical keys in that they can be programmed to open or close doors or gates with a single push. They are very popular because they are more practical than regular keys.

Transponder technology is utilized in modern cars to deter theft and to start the car when the fob or key is placed in. The chips are incorporated in the key fob or an individual transponder that is placed in a metal slot in your ignition. A receiver in the car's circuitry recognizes the code transmitted by the transponder and transmits an indication to the car's computer that the key has been inserted. The process takes milliseconds and isn't noticeable, but it's necessary to allow the car to start.

Some cars can be programmed in just a few minutes using the onboard procedure or by connecting an OBD2 port. Certain cars require more complicated programming procedures like EEPROM. EEPROM is the most complex type of car key programming, and it requires removing specific modules from your car in order to read the key data stored on them.

In general, you can program most automobiles using an onboard procedure or by using a programer that connects to the OBD2 port. However, certain models might require a more advanced method called EEPROM programming. These procedures can be complicated and damage your car system if not performed by a professional.

Check the owner's manual for your car to learn the specific steps outlined by the manufacturer.
